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 91380 - OOoView-1.1-r1.ebuild (New Package)
Summary: OOoView-1.1-r1.ebuild (New Package)
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All All
: High enhancement (vote)
Assignee: Gentoo Office Team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-05-03 20:09 UTC by Mike Pagano
Modified: 2006-02-02 11:00 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
OOoView-1.1-r1.ebuild (New Package) (OOoView-1.1-r1.ebuild,1.24 KB, text/plain)
2005-05-03 20:10 UTC, Mike Pagano
Details
1-1.oooview-calc launch script (New) (1.1-oooview-calc,237 bytes, text/plain)
2005-05-03 20:11 UTC, Mike Pagano
Details
1-1.oooview-impress launch script (New) (1.1-oooview-impress,249 bytes, text/plain)
2005-05-03 20:12 UTC, Mike Pagano
Details
1-1.oooview-writer launch script (New) (1.1-oooview-writer,245 bytes, text/plain)
2005-05-03 20:13 UTC, Mike Pagano
Details
OOoView-1.1-r1.ebuild (Update). (OOoView-1.1-r1.ebuild,1.23 KB, text/plain)
2005-05-04 04:58 UTC, Mike Pagano
Details
OOoView-1.1-r1.ebuild (Update) (OOoView-1.1-r1.ebuild,1.75 KB, text/plain)
2005-05-04 14:35 UTC, Mike Pagano
Details
1.1-OOoView.sh (New) (1.1-OOoView.sh,511 bytes, text/plain)
2005-05-04 14:36 UTC, Mike Pagano
Details
ooo_calc.png icon (New) (ooo_calc.png,988 bytes, image/png)
2005-05-04 14:36 UTC, Mike Pagano
Details
ooo_impress.png icon (New) (ooo_impress.png,1002 bytes, image/png)
2005-05-04 14:37 UTC, Mike Pagano
Details
ooo_writer.png icon (New) (ooo_writer.png,963 bytes, image/png)
2005-05-04 14:38 UTC, Mike Pagano
Details
OOoView-1.1-r1.ebuild (Update) (OOoView-1.1-r1.ebuild,1.57 KB, text/plain)
2005-05-04 18:23 UTC, Mike Pagano
Details
University of the Philippines license for OOoView (uph,184 bytes, text/plain)
2005-05-06 02:49 UTC, Roland Bär
Details
OOoView-1.1_p20050508.ebuild (New) (OOoView-1.1_p20050508.ebuild,2.59 KB, text/plain)
2005-05-24 19:01 UTC, Mike Pagano
Details
1.1_p20050508-OOoView.sh (Update) (1.1_p20050508-OOoView.sh,973 bytes, text/plain)
2005-05-24 19:03 UTC, Mike Pagano
Details
1.1_p20050508-OOoView.sh (Update) (1.1_p20050508-OOoView.sh,979 bytes, text/plain)
2005-06-01 04:52 UTC, Mike Pagano
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Mike Pagano gentoo-dev 2005-05-03 20:09:31 UTC
Hello.

Please find attached an OOoView-1.1-r1.ebuild and three scripts for starting the program. This is a viewer for OpenOffice writer, calc and Impress written in java.

Description: In 2003, the group of Christine Bejerasco, Cipriano Consolacion Jr., and Raquel Tarroza, under the supervision of Prof. R.Feria, have created a prototype of an OpenOffice.org file viewer. The viewer, called OOoView, was written in Java to ensure that it runs on any platform with a proper Java Virtual Machine. This application allows users to view OpenOffice.org files without installing OpenOffice.org or StarOffice.

You can read more here: https://oooview.dev.java.net/ or here: http://os.up.edu.ph/modules.php?name=Downloads&d_op=viewdownload&cid=2

I had to write the three scripts since upstream does not provide any way to run the program, only jar files.

NOTE: This is my first ebuild submission so I welcome all comments and suggestions.

Mike
Comment 1 Mike Pagano gentoo-dev 2005-05-03 20:10:53 UTC
Created attachment 57978 [details]
OOoView-1.1-r1.ebuild (New Package)
Comment 2 Mike Pagano gentoo-dev 2005-05-03 20:11:52 UTC
Created attachment 57979 [details]
1-1.oooview-calc launch script (New)
Comment 3 Mike Pagano gentoo-dev 2005-05-03 20:12:21 UTC
Created attachment 57981 [details]
1-1.oooview-impress launch script (New)
Comment 4 Mike Pagano gentoo-dev 2005-05-03 20:13:00 UTC
Created attachment 57982 [details]
1-1.oooview-writer launch script (New)
Comment 5 Roland Bär 2005-05-04 01:32:23 UTC
Hello Mike,

just had a quick look at your ebuild, following "findings"
- Leading space at lines 27, 32, 46
Use tab for indenting. You can run "repoman" in that directory for sanity
checks.

The license is currently "limited", until they release source code under GPL..

Roland
Comment 6 Mike Pagano gentoo-dev 2005-05-04 04:58:09 UTC
Created attachment 58026 [details]
OOoView-1.1-r1.ebuild (Update).

Applied Roland's suggestions and fixed space->tab issues on lines specified.
Comment 7 Mike Pagano gentoo-dev 2005-05-04 14:35:04 UTC
Created attachment 58070 [details]
OOoView-1.1-r1.ebuild (Update)

More changes based on Roland's suggestions.  There is now one run script with
symlinks for writer,calc and impress.  The help file is now extracted from the
jar and installed.

Thanks, Roland.
Comment 8 Mike Pagano gentoo-dev 2005-05-04 14:36:13 UTC
Created attachment 58071 [details]
1.1-OOoView.sh (New)

This one run script replaces the three previous ones attached.
Comment 9 Mike Pagano gentoo-dev 2005-05-04 14:36:59 UTC
Created attachment 58072 [details]
ooo_calc.png icon (New)

Icon for calc viewer.
Comment 10 Mike Pagano gentoo-dev 2005-05-04 14:37:32 UTC
Created attachment 58073 [details]
ooo_impress.png icon (New)

Icon for Impress viewer.
Comment 11 Mike Pagano gentoo-dev 2005-05-04 14:38:00 UTC
Created attachment 58074 [details]
ooo_writer.png icon (New)

Icon for Writer viewer.
Comment 12 Mike Pagano gentoo-dev 2005-05-04 18:23:53 UTC
Created attachment 58089 [details]
OOoView-1.1-r1.ebuild (Update)

Removed debug einfo statements
Comment 13 Roland Bär 2005-05-06 02:49:59 UTC
Created attachment 58193 [details]
University of the Philippines license for OOoView
Comment 14 Mike Pagano gentoo-dev 2005-05-06 06:53:49 UTC
I emailed the professor asking about the source availability.  He responded that the source is available on the project page:

https://oooview.dev.java.net/source/browse/oooview/

His response:

"Hi Mike,

The source is included at java.net.

Cheers!"

Would this be considered adequate to satisfy Gentoo concerning GPL compliance?
Comment 15 Mike Pagano gentoo-dev 2005-05-09 11:25:46 UTC
So, it appears that the professor's web page might be a little old and the project page contains more up-to-date info.

The project page clearly states the code is GPL'ed and offers a web interface to the source code.

I have a cvs snapshot ebuild and package I will attach shortly.

Mike
Comment 16 Mike Pagano gentoo-dev 2005-05-24 19:01:45 UTC
Created attachment 59755 [details]
OOoView-1.1_p20050508.ebuild (New)

I worked on a snapshot ebuild for this product.  The snapshot is 124k. Unless a
dev tells me to attach the snapshot I used, here's the cvs commands I used to
ge the snap shot:

cvs -d :pserver:mpagano@cvs.dev.java.net:/cvs login
cvs -d :pserver:mpagano@cvs.dev.java.net:/cvs checkout -r 1.1 -I CVS oooview
tar -czvf OOoView-1.1.tar.gz oooview

The new ebuild is attached.
Comment 17 Mike Pagano gentoo-dev 2005-05-24 19:03:04 UTC
Created attachment 59756 [details]
1.1_p20050508-OOoView.sh (Update)

This is an updated start script. Soft links will be made from the writer, calc
and impress start scripts to this one start script.
Comment 18 Mike Pagano gentoo-dev 2005-06-01 04:52:12 UTC
Created attachment 60354 [details]
1.1_p20050508-OOoView.sh (Update)

This is an updated start script. Execute the java command in the background via
the ampersand.
Comment 19 Andreas Proschofsky (RETIRED) gentoo-dev 2006-01-29 04:24:53 UTC
Is this project still actively developed? Cause I don't want to put something in the tree that is "experimental" and has no future. The last cvs commit seems to have been in April. 
Comment 20 Mike Pagano gentoo-dev 2006-01-29 04:53:15 UTC
Then don't commit it. Don't see much demand for it anyway.
Comment 21 Andreas Proschofsky (RETIRED) gentoo-dev 2006-02-02 11:00:46 UTC
@Mike: I'm turning this down for the moment. Thanks for your work anyway and sorry for not responding in a more timely fashion. Please reopen this bug if the upstream work continues / there is an actual release